Transaction 23959290ef78be71a56c3ca22f0a76020a992ebaa2d6ee4071ec690c3474d9ef

2 Input
2 Outputs
  • 23959290ef78be71a56c3ca22f0a76020a992ebaa2d6ee4071ec690c3474d9ef:0
  • value  4683928
    address  1DKbqd5p7Gpa2pgMeJ9m85SJhz2o7DwC8v
  • 23959290ef78be71a56c3ca22f0a76020a992ebaa2d6ee4071ec690c3474d9ef:1
  • value  13934865
    address  bc1qwa29aafk6zsxhhk7z372kzrwmakp7r88mqc8x7